St Johns County Public Library System Administrative Office Coordinator, Angelina Gervasi, informed local Historic City News reporters in St Augustine of the following summertime library activities planned for June at the Ponte Vedra Beach Branch Library Events Telephone: (904) 827-6950.
Teen Summer Reading Program
Teen Summer Reading Program will be from June 1st – August 4th. Middle school and high school students are invited to participate in your own summer reading program! Simply read whatever you like and fill out a review on each book read to be entered into a weekly raffle. Weekly prizes are brand-new books for middle and high school youth. Book reviews will be entered into the grand prize raffle in August.
